Libido Sudden Increase?



Recommended Posts

Hi Everybody,

I am 4 months out and 68 years old. I am almost too embarassed to ask this, but you're family right? I know there is improvement in body image as a factor in libido, but I have had such an increase (like someone turned the switch to on) that I have never experienced anything like this even when I was in my 20's and in great shape. Believe me, my husband isn't complaining, he just feels like he's sleeping with a new woman LOL! I am concerned, however, feeling like this has become an obsession. I know some people would say go with the flow (no pun intended), but I feel out of control. I read somewhere that as fat cells shrink they release hormones, not sure what kind. My husband is concerned that the switch will just as suddenly be turned to off. I know some won't consider this a problem, but I truly am worried.

All I can speak for is the guys and YES the ratio of testosterone per pound increases so it's just like getting a "booster shot". I had to start T shots a few years ago and had to cut waaayyy back on my dosage, becasue as I lost a lot of weight the T level went through the roof.

I understand that estrogen is also stored in fat so as it's burned the ladies also get a "boost" in sex drive too.
